Design of Diffractive Optical Elements for Shaping the Laser Intensity Distribution

摘要

We present simple designs of diffractive optical elements for generating high quality laser beams of different spatial shapes with uniform intensity distribution. The numerical results are presented for uniform intensity laser beams with annular, rectangular and square spatial shapes. We found that these beams exhibit small depth of focus (propagation distance over which the shape of a beam remains preserved). We also found that our designs have good tolerance against the possible errors caused by imperfections and noise.
